pitch in

 

Definitions from WordNet

Verb pitch in has 1 sense
  1. pitch in, dig in - eat heartily; "The food was placed on the table and the children pitched in"

Pitch In

Part of Speech: Verb

Sense: To help or contribute to a common goal, especially by doing one's share of work or contributing money.

Usage:

  1. Let's pitch in and clean up the park for the community event.
  2. Everyone needs to pitch in and raise funds for the charity drive.
  3. If we all pitch in, we can finish this project ahead of the deadline.
  4. Make sure to pitch in with your ideas during the team meeting.

Part of Speech: Phrasal Verb

Sense: To offer, contribute, or donate.

Usage:

  1. He pitched in some money to help cover the expenses.
  2. The company pitched in and donated supplies to the local school.
